What Are Commercial Pressure Washing Services?

Pressure washing is a highly efficient way to keep your building’s exterior surfaces free of mold, mildew, mud, grime, and any other unsightly contaminants. Commercial pressure washing services utilize a portable machine composed of a gas or electric engine, a pump and a hose through which water flows. Thanks to a high-pressure nozzle at the end of the hose, the machine blasts water at a high intensity to remove everything from dust to chipping paint from outside surfaces. Our machines go a step further by using a bar with high-powered jets that rotate and swivel when the water flows through them. Because of this, it is easier for City Wide’s technicians to provide a uniform clean in a shorter time frame than traditional methods.

The process has come a long way since pressure washers were first invented in 1926, but the mechanics remain the same. Utilizing the power of water – and a bit of cleaner – these low-to-high pressure systems are ideal for making short work of big jobs on nearly all exterior surfaces. How Else Is Pressure Washing Useful?

While giving your building, parking lot, sidewalks or fencing an instant makeover is a major perk of commercial pressure washing services, another aspect is even more beneficial: protection. Mold, mildew, algae and other forms of bacteria can wreak havoc on your building and create a much larger problem than just looking unattractive. When left untreated, these problematic substances can spread and infiltrate the interior of your facility. The spread of black old can even cause a property to temporarily shut down on the basis of creating an unfit working environment. It is vital to be mindful of these things if your building is constructed of brick, concrete blocks or another porous material, as mold hides in their small holes. Our technicians use the correct amount of water pressure for your surface to ensure dangerous contaminants are thoroughly removed before the job is complete. By making commercial pressure washing services a regular part of your building’s maintenance, your company can save time and money in the long run on pricey restoration and repairs. After all, consistent upkeep ensures that your property maintains the longest life possible.

You may also consider safety when deciding if pressure washing is the correct service for your establishment. As we have mentioned, mold, algae and other elements can build up over time. While some of these things are harmless and mostly a cosmetic issue, some can be downright dangerous. Mold or algae build-up on walkways can become a slipping hazard. Grease can pose the same issue, especially in parking lots. Having mold or an excess of dust and dirt in places where employees or customers gather – such as a courtyard – can irritate nasal passages and make breathing difficult. Many people think it is easy to rent a pressure washer from a local hardware store and take care of the job themselves; is that really in your job description? This service is best left to a trained professional, as the amount of pressure produced by these machines can be damaging to your property if not used with care. Too much pressure can chip your paint or remove layers from your wooden decks or fences. Too little pressure causes a waste of water and energy, as you have to repeat the process again and again to achieve your desired results.
